Description Jaap van Wingerde 2008-07-23 12:53:23 UTC
Version:           4.3.5.9.dfsg.1-2+b1 (using Devel)
Installed from:    Compiled sources
OS:                Linux

<http://groups.google.com/group/nl.comp.os.linux.x/browse_thread/thread/fb0570257c0484cd/a1f5ffa4d8578a34#a1f5ffa4d8578a34>:

The window decoration is missing and the keyboard is not working on screen 2.
Linux 2.6.25-2-amd64, Debian Lenny
X.Org X Server 1.4.2 + fglrx
Asus Radeon 9600 SE

Workaround:
kwin --replace in terminal
Comment 1 lucas 2008-07-23 13:28:48 UTC
If someone could create an English summary of that thread it would be a great help. Guessing dualhead mode, quite possibly a misconfiguration of X as the keyboard isn't working.
Comment 2 Jaap van Wingerde 2008-07-23 20:47:16 UTC
Dualhead mode indeed. With Gnome everything is fine. Also after "kwin --replace" in a terminal. So it is no misconfiguration of X.
Comment 3 Jaap van Wingerde 2008-07-28 22:36:39 UTC
Synaptic installed Debian testing package kwin version 4:3.5.9.dfsg.1-4. The problem is not solved.
Comment 4 lucas 2008-07-29 01:35:40 UTC
I think I'm getting this problem. It's not that it's not starting, KWin is starting but it crashes with a QVector assert the moment a window is displayed on it.
Comment 5 Jaap van Wingerde 2008-08-07 14:03:53 UTC
Problem not solved with Debian testing (Lenny) package kwin version 4:3.5.9.dfsg.1-5.
